The noticing qualities such as the level of Sensitivity and Quality factor (Q-factor) are evaluated deliberately. A two-dimensional photonic crystal (2DPC) centered stress sensing unit is modeled and designed. The 2DPC centered pressure sensing unit is designed using holes in slab configuration. The L3 defect is created by customizing the spans of three silicon poles and is introduced between two waveguides. It has been revealed that the sensor’s wavelength is transferred linearly to a larger wavelength area, which improves the sensor’s performance.
